Jaguar C-X75 supercar program halted
Tue, 11 Dec 2012Jaguar has dropped plans to put the C-X75 hybrid-powered supercar into production, according to a report Tuesday by Autocar magazine in the UK. The reason is struggling economies around the world, the magazine said, citing Jaguar brand director Adrian Hallmark. Jaguar planned to launch the C-X75 next year and had partnered with the Williams Formula One team to help develop it.
Mini Clubman concept (2014) first official pictures
Wed, 26 Feb 2014By Damion Smy First Official Pictures 26 February 2014 09:00 This is the new Mini Clubman Concept and, your eyes aren’t playing tricks on you – it has more doors than ever. The new four-door (well, six if you could the two-piece rear opening) is the first Mini to have two sets of cabin doors, and will offer the same range of three- and four-cylinder engines as the rest of the range. Just as the Fiat 500 range is expanding in terms of size, doors and oddity, the Mini family is growing too. While officially it’s a concept, given the brand’s history of production ready showcars, you won’t have to squint too hard – or at all – for the road-going version.
Local Motors launches Pacific Northwest competition
Wed, 17 Mar 2010Local Motors' 20th design competition, themed 'Thrive in the Elements,' opens for submissions starting today, 17 March. The new American car company is calling for entrants to design a car based around the four core elements: Earth, wind, fire and water; challenging designers to create a vehicle that will 'inspire Pacific Northwesterners to thrive'. The deadline for entries is 30 March 2010.
